Specification of Original Japan Ceramic Bearing 608 Alumina Ceramic Wear Rings 608 Ceramic Bearing

This Initial Japan Ceramic Bearing is the 608 dimension. It uses high-grade alumina ceramic for the balls and wear rings. The internal and external rings are made from zirconia oxide ceramic. This material mix supplies remarkable efficiency.

The measurements are typical: 8mm inner bore, 22mm external diameter, 7mm size. It fits applications needing a 608 bearing. The construct concentrates on severe longevity and smooth procedure. Precision engineering ensures minimal friction right from the beginning.
